Transaction 233613fcb6e123098366d2dd1efca6cd59c37b46de6a200c8bbbe6a2c25ba229
1 Input
1 Outputs
- 233613fcb6e123098366d2dd1efca6cd59c37b46de6a200c8bbbe6a2c25ba229:0
value 4349442
address 12bwfeHT1YTwoFUBmwiykwbTi4vRoxWJ7v